如何linux服务器

fiy 其他 10

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    搭建一个Linux服务器需要经过以下步骤:

    1.选择合适的Linux发行版:根据服务器需求,选择适合的Linux发行版,例如CentOS、Ubuntu等。

    2.购买合适的服务器:选择一台性能稳定、资源丰富的服务器,可以选择自己搭建或购买云服务器。

    3.安装Linux操作系统:根据选择的Linux发行版,按照官方文档或教程进行系统安装。

    4.更新系统和软件:安装完成后,使用系统自带的软件包管理工具或命令更新系统和软件,确保系统和软件处于最新版本,并修复安全漏洞。

    5.设置网络连接:配置服务器的网络连接,包括IP地址、子网掩码、网关等。

    6.安装必要的软件:根据服务器需求,安装所需的软件,如Web服务器(如Apache、Nginx)、数据库服务器(如MySQL、PostgreSQL)、FTP服务器、邮件服务器等。

    7.配置防火墙和安全设置:配置服务器的防火墙,限制网络访问和保护服务器安全。设置强密码、限制登录权限、开启SSH密钥登录等安全措施。

    8.备份和恢复:定期备份重要数据和配置文件,以便在意外情况下能够恢复服务器。

    9.监控和优化:安装监控工具,监控服务器的性能和运行状况,及时发现并解决问题。优化服务器的性能,包括优化网络、硬件和软件配置等。

    10.配置域名和SSL证书:如果需要将服务器用于网站或应用程序,配置域名解析和安装SSL证书,确保网站的安全性和可信度。

    11.测试和上线:在配置完成后,进行测试和调试,确保服务器的各项功能正常运行。最后,将服务器正式上线,并监控运行情况,维护服务器的稳定性和安全性。

    以上是搭建Linux服务器的一般步骤,具体的操作和配置可能会有所差异,需要根据实际情况进行调整。此外,还可以参考相关的书籍、网站教程和论坛等资源,以获取更详细的指导和帮助。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    如何搭建Linux服务器

    Linux服务器作为一种强大而稳定的服务器操作系统,被广泛应用于各种企业和个人的服务器环境。下面是一些关于如何搭建Linux服务器的指南和步骤,以帮助您顺利配置和运行服务器。

    1.选择合适的Linux发行版:有许多不同的Linux发行版可供选择,如Ubuntu、CentOS、Debian等。您可以根据您的需求和经验来选择适合您的发行版。

    2.准备服务器硬件:在开始之前,您需要准备一台适合的服务器硬件。这包括选择合适的CPU、内存、硬盘和网络接口等。确保硬件配置符合您的预期业务需求。

    3.下载并安装Linux发行版:下载您选择的Linux发行版的ISO镜像,并将其写入可启动的USB驱动器或DVD光盘。将服务器从可启动设备引导,并按照安装向导的指示进行安装。

    4.进行基本配置:一旦安装完成,您需要进行一些基本配置来保证服务器的安全性和性能。包括设置管理员密码、更新系统软件包、配置系统和网络设置等。

    5.安装和配置服务器软件:根据您的需求,安装和配置适当的服务器软件。例如,如果您要搭建Web服务器,您可能需要安装Apache或Nginx。如果您要搭建数据库服务器,您可能需要安装MySQL或PostgreSQL。

    6.进行安全设置:服务器安全非常重要,您需要采取一些安全措施来保护服务器和其上运行的应用程序。例如,配置防火墙、禁用不必要的服务、配置访问控制列表等。

    7.进行性能优化:为了提高服务器的性能,您可以进行一些性能优化措施。例如,优化网络设置、调整系统内核参数、使用缓存等。

    8.备份和监控:定期备份服务器上的数据是至关重要的。您可以设置自动备份策略来保护数据。另外,在服务器上安装监控工具,可以实时监测服务器的性能和运行状况,并及时处理问题。

    以上是搭建Linux服务器的一些建议和步骤。请记住,服务器设置需要根据您的具体需求和经验来进行配置,所以一定要根据实际情况做出相应的调整。另外,随着技术的不断发展,保持学习和更新对于服务器的运维工作非常重要。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ux服务器配置和操作流程如下:

    1. 安装Linux操作系统
      首先,需要选择适合的Linux发行版并将其下载到服务器上。然后,通过引导设备安装程序启动服务器,并按照安装向导的指示进行操作。在安装过程中,需要选择磁盘分区、创建用户账户、设置网络等。

    2. 更新系统及软件包
      安装完成后,首先要运行系统更新命令,以获取最新的安全补丁和软件包。在大多数Linux发行版中,可以使用以下命令进行系统更新:

      sudo apt update
      sudo apt upgrade
      
    3. 配置网络
      要使Linux服务器能够访问Internet或局域网,需要配置网络设置。可以使用编辑器(如nano或vim)打开网络配置文件,并根据需要设置IP地址、网关、DNS等网络参数。在大多数Linux发行版中,网络配置文件位于/etc/network/interfaces/etc/sysconfig/network-scripts目录下。

    4. 安装所需软件
      服务器通常需要安装一些额外的软件来运行特定的服务或应用程序。常见的软件包管理工具有:apt(Debian/Ubuntu),yum(CentOS/RHEL),zypper(openSUSE),dnf(Fedora)。使用相应的软件包管理工具安装所需软件,例如:

      sudo apt install apache2           //安装Apache Web服务器
      sudo yum install mysql-server      //安装MySQL数据库服务器
      sudo zypper install nginx          //安装Nginx Web服务器
      
    5. 配置防火墙
      为了保护服务器安全,需要配置防火墙以限制网络访问。常用的Linux防火墙工具有iptables和ufw。使用相应的命令配置防火墙规则,例如:

      sudo iptables -A INPUT -p tcp --dport 80 -j ACCEPT    //允许HTTP(80端口)访问
      sudo ufw allow ssh                                   //允许SSH访问
      
    6. 配置并启动服务
      安装完成后,可能需要对所安装的服务进行一些配置。例如,配置Web服务器的虚拟主机、MySQL数据库的用户权限等。然后,可以使用以下命令启动对应的服务:

      sudo systemctl start apache2.service      //启动Apache Web服务器
      sudo systemctl start mysqld.service      //启动MySQL数据库服务器
      sudo systemctl start nginx.service       //启动Nginx Web服务器
      
    7. 监控服务器状态
      为了及时发现服务器的性能问题和故障,可以安装一些服务器监控工具。常见的服务器监控工具包括:Nagios、Zabbix、Ganglia等。这些工具可以监视服务器的CPU利用率、内存使用情况、磁盘空间、网络流量等指标,并发出警报或报告。

    8. 定期备份数据
      数据备份是确保服务器数据安全的重要措施。可以使用工具(如rsync或tar)来定期备份服务器上的关键数据到远程位置或本地存储介质。也可以考虑使用云备份服务(如AWS S3或Google Cloud Storage)进行数据备份。

    总结:以上是配置和操作Linux服务器的基本流程。根据需要,还可以进一步进行服务器优化、安全加固、性能调优等工作。对于初学者,如果在配置和操作过程中遇到问题,可以查阅相关的文档和教程,或者寻求社区的帮助。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部